[-- Attachment #1 --] On Tue, May 24, 2005 at 11:45:57PM -0500, Mark Cole wrote: > I am running 4.10-RELEASE. I installed gcc33 and later gcc34 (not at the > same time) and > had the same problem with both. The problem is that when logged on as a > user, I get the error > "gcc34: installation problem, cannot exec `cc1': No such file or directory" > when I try to compile. However, it works fine as root. > > > Any suggestions? Check your path and other environment variables.
